Tourist arrivals rise by 19.5 per cent in June 2026 compared to last year

Kathmandu. KATHMANDU: A total of 91,363 foreign tourists visited Nepal in the month of June, 2026. According to the data released by the Nepal Tourism Board (NTB), the number of tourists visiting Nepal via air route has increased by 19.5 percent in June as compared to the previous year.

This number was 76,425 in the same month last year. Similarly, the highest tourist activity before the Covid-19 pandemic was 74,883 in June 2019. On this basis, it increased by 22.01 percent in June this year.

The highest number of tourists visiting Nepal in June was 48,254 from the SAARC countries. This is 52.8 percent of the total arrivals. Among the major source markets, 41,809 tourists came from India alone. A total of 16,152 tourists from other Asian countries visited Nepal, which is 17.68 percent of the total arrival. Of them, 8,875 tourists arrived from China, 2,497 from Japan, 1,765 from South Korea and 984 from Thailand.

A total of 13,119 tourists from Europe have visited Nepal. Among the European countries, 3,266 tourists arrived from the United Kingdom, 1,892 from Germany and 1,267 from France. A total of 6,954 tourists from the United States of America visited Nepal, which is 7.61 percent of the total arrivals. Likewise, 5,237 tourists arrived from the United States of America, 1,298 from Canada and 219 from Brazil.

Similarly, 3,090 tourists have arrived in Nepal from the Oceania region. This is 56.35 percent over the previous year and 57.17 percent more than in 2019. A total of 2,694 tourists from Australia and 390 from New Zealand visited the region. A total of 674 tourists from Africa and 292 tourists from the Middle East visited Nepal.

NTB senior officer Santosh Bikram Thapa said the increase in tourist arrivals is a result of expansion of international air connectivity, tourism promotion campaign, and publicity of major source markets and image of Nepal as a safe and attractive destination.

The Board has said that it is preparing to carry out more promotional activities in India, China, America, Europe and other major source markets targeting the upcoming tourism season.
